Ear is feeling plugged​
I recently tried swimming for the first time, after which one of my ear still feels plugged. It's been already couple of days. Any advice is greatly appreciated.

Drop into my clinic. Before you entered the water you had wax partially occluding the ear, so it did not affect your hearing. However when you entered the water, the water went beyond the wax and got trapped between the wax and your eardrum causing the "Occlusal Effect" or blocked ears!
